Adjusting Volume
Adjusting Ringer Volume
You can make the phone ring louder or quieter by adjusting
its volume.
To adjust the ringer volume:
1. Press Menu, scroll to Profiles, and press Select.
2. Scroll to the profile you wish to modify (Normal is the
default) and press Select.
3. Scroll to Customize and press Select.
4. Scroll to Ringing volume and press Select.
5. Scroll to your preferred level (Level 1–Level 5) and press Select.
Adjusting Earpiece Volume
During a call, you can adjust the volume to better hear the
other caller.
To adjust the earpiece volume during a call:
䡵 Press the left scroll key to decrease the volume.
䡵 Press the right scroll key to increase the volume.
The volume level will remain unchanged unless adjusted again.
